Based on 129 recent sales, the median property price is £250,000 (about £275 per square foot) in Rodbourne Cheney area, with individual transactions ranging from £92,000 up to £700,000.
| Type | Sales | Median | £/sq ft |
|---|---|---|---|
| Detached | 17 | £340,000 | £281 |
| Semi-Detached | 44 | £272,500 | £286 |
| Terraced | 57 | £235,000 | £266 |
| Flats | 11 | £140,000 | £211 |

Postcode SN2 2LF is located in an urban city, within the Rodbourne Cheney ward of Swindon in the South West region, and forms part of the Moredon area. It has high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 68.5 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 20% below the South West average of 85 per 1,000. The average income per household in Moredon is £46,225 per year. The nearest station is Swindon (Wilts), about 1.2 miles away. There are 9 primary and 2 secondary schools in the area.
Moredon has a high level of deprivation, ranked at position 11,141 out of 32,844 areas in the United Kingdom, placing it within the top 34% most deprived areas in England.
Moredon has a high crime rate, with approximately 68.5 reported incidents per 1,000 population each year.
Approximately 25.5% of homes on this street are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. Across the surrounding area, around 26.3% of dwellings are socially rented.
The average income per household in Moredon is £46,225 per year.
No significant noise sources from railways or roads near SN2 2LF.
Moredon near SN2 2LF has no flood risk (less than 0.1% chance of a flood each year) from rivers and sea.
The nearest station is Swindon (Wilts) located about 1.2 miles away. There are no other stations nearby.
In the SN2 2LF postcode area, located within Moredon, there are 9 primary and 2 secondary schools in close proximity.
